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96 21975 02253691711 6992
7943 66999439426 3018395969
7943 66999439426 3018395969
55102323009 416 76186
All about undefined
Interested in learning more?
7943 66999439426 3018395969
55102323009 416 76186
See more
992 0577021653 2933526
6969425587 6113946366 430
See more
1592 327
317823 634528 78343093
See more